Abstract:

Contains documents and photographs that relate to the experiences of Michael Semler's family, which was originally from Germany but relocated to the San Francisco Bay Area before, during, and after the Holocaust. It consists primarily of corresondence between friends and family; photographs and negative of friends and family; and ephemera and publications relating to travel in Europe. Much of the material is in German.

Michael Semler of Alameda, California, donated this collection of family documents and photographs in 2005.
